How they compare
Kiribati currently reports 23.94 % change on previous year against 23.6 % change on previous year in Monaco, a difference of 0.34 % change on previous year.
The two have swapped places 8 times across 14 shared years of data; in 2011 it was Kiribati ahead.
Kiribati ranks 21st and Monaco ranks 22nd of 207 countries.
Across the 2 decades both report, Kiribati averaged higher in 1 and Monaco in 1.

About this data
The year-on-year percentage change in Industry (including construction), value added (current LCU). Computed from consecutive annual observations; years either side of a gap are skipped rather than bridged.
